Watch 'Two Minutes to Late Night' Cover the Misfits

Another week, another cover from Two Minutes to Late Night. The latest hardcore cover they tackle is the Misfits’ “Halloween II” —the B-side of the band’s 1981 self-released single, “Halloween.” The rendition brings a solid set of musicians including bassist Liam Wilson (the Dillinger Escape Plan/Azusa), guitarist Abby Rhine (Life’s Question), drummer Danny Lomeli (Incendiary) […]

Phoebe Bridgers Now Has Her Own Record Label

Phoebe Bridgers has had an impressive 2020. There have been plenty of accolades and now you can add label boss to her impressive resume. Called Saddest Factory, it is a partnership with Bridgers’ current label, Dead Oceans. “The vision of the label is simple: good songs, regardless of genre,” Bridgers said in a statement. In an […]
